Democrats Strategize to ‘Trump-Proof’ Policies Ahead of 2024 Election

Democratic state officials are adopting a comprehensive strategy known as “Trump-proofing” to prepare for the possibility of Donald Trump returning to office. This approach includes stockpiling abortion pills, securing environmental regulations, and safeguarding marriage equality. Leaders express determination to counteract anticipated federal rollbacks on progressive policies. With lessons learned from Trump’s first term, states are gearing up for potential legal battles to protect their constituents from threats posed by a possible Trump presidency.

Democratic state leaders across the United States are implementing a strategy termed “Trump-proofing” in preparation for the upcoming Election Day, amid concerns about a potential return of former President Donald Trump. This initiative involves various measures including the stockpiling of abortion pills in Washington and Massachusetts, direct climate agreements between California and automakers, and urgent actions to safeguard same-sex marriage rights in Colorado. These proactive efforts reflect the apprehension that a Trump administration could target fundamental rights and environmental policies that progressives have worked to secure. Despite showcasing confidence in Vice President Kamala Harris as their nominee, Democrats recognize the importance of having contingency plans in place. The approach, though largely decentralized, showcases a trend of states acting independently yet collaboratively to bolster their defenses against a possible Trump presidency, as they work to replicate precedents from his previous tenure. In stark contrast to the surprise unleashed by Trump’s 2016 win, Democratic leaders now feel better prepared both legally and strategically. They anticipate that the conservative tilt of the federal judiciary and the Supreme Court poses a significant challenge, yet express optimism regarding their state-level maneuvers. Robert Rivas, the speaker of the California Assembly, voiced their resolve by stating, “If Donald Trump should somehow be reelected, we’ll be ready from day one to respond.” States are adopting a multifaceted self-defensive framework, particularly concerning issues such as reproductive rights, climate change policies, and civil rights. Notable examples include Washington’s distribution of 30,000 doses of mifepristone, an abortion pill safeguarded against potential future regulations by a Trump-led federal government. Similarly, California has secured agreements with major vehicle manufacturers to comply with stringent environmental standards, irrespective of federal interventions. Looking back at Trump’s previous administration, California lawmakers recognized the importance of resilience through litigation, a strategy poised to reemerge if Trump regains office. California Attorney General Rob Bonta emphasized this preparation by stating, “Fortunately and unfortunately, we have four years of Trump 1.0 under our belt.” Furthermore, Democratic states are enhancing their efforts towards legal countermeasures, reflecting lessons learned from past battles. The anticipation of legal skirmishes bodes well for Democratic leadership, as they leverage their experience to strategize against potential federal overreach and protect critical rights.
